Discover the Ultimate Backcountry Experience in the Southern Alps

New Zealand’s Southern Alps are a paradise for freeriders, ski tourers, and split-boarders seeking untouched powder, thrilling descents, and remote backcountry terrain. With exclusive 4WD access, private heated huts, and heli-assisted options, these adventures offer an unparalleled way to explore the alpine wilderness.

Freeride & Big Mountain Skiing

For those who crave steep lines and deep powder, New Zealand’s backcountry delivers. Our freeride adventures take you to untouched alpine basins, towering peaks, and exhilarating descents, far from the crowds of ski resorts.

Top Freeride Destinations:

⛷️ Cass Valley Freeride – Remote, rugged, and packed with thrilling terrain.

🏂 Erewhon Hut, Potts Range – Steep couloirs and wide-open powder fields in a breathtaking setting.

Ski Touring & Split-Boarding Expeditions

For those who love the freedom of the backcountry, ski touring and split-board adventures offer an unforgettable mix of exploration and challenge. With heated private huts and diverse terrain, these journeys provide the perfect blend of comfort and adventure.

Top Ski Touring & Split-Boarding Destinations:

🏂 Cass Valley Ski Touring – A multi-day adventure with great terrain and endless options.

⛷️ Two Thumb Range – A ski touring classic, perfect for all levels. Stunning views across Lake Tekapo.

Heli-Assisted Backcountry Adventures

Maximize your time in the mountains with heli-ski touring and heli-splitboarding, accessing remote peaks and untouched snowfields with the ease of a helicopter drop-off. Spend the day touring remote backcountry terrain and untouched slopes with your experienced ski guide. From high-alpine glaciers to hidden valleys, these experiences offer the best of New Zealand’s backcountry skiing and riding.

Why Choose a Guided Backcountry Adventure?

✔ Exclusive Access – Remote locations, private land, and uncrowded terrain.

✔ Heated Private Huts – Stay warm and comfortable in our fully equipped backcountry huts.

✔ Expert Local Guides – Professional IFMGA & NZMGA qualified ski guides, safety-focused, and passionate about the mountains.

✔ Technical Equipment – Alpine Recreation provides quality, modern ski touring and avalanche rescue equipment free-of-charge.
